During one of the interviews with Hasbro's Marvel team, Dwight hinted that he eventually wants to do a retro line based on the Ghost Rider line from Toybiz (for more info - https://www.figurerealm.com/actionfigure?action=seriesitemlist&id=90). People have started listing their wants for the wave on the Q+A thread in the news section but I thought we would all start listing them here. 

A couple of things to note though. DO NOT expect the bikes to come in this line. There wouldn't be enough room on the card back format for a bike. Plus it would drive the price of the figure through the roof.

Second thing is, just because a character was in the old line doesn't mean it should be in this line and just cause a character wasn't in the line, doesn't mean it shouldn't be in this line. But I would say try and pick character that would have been around those time. They try and make the figure as if they were trying to make a line during those times. TLDR: no Robbie Reyes guys. sorry.
